
Former WWE Champion Big E has confirmed that Rusev – known as Miro in AEW – will be making a return to WWE.
In early February, news emerged that Miro/Rusev had been released from his AEW contract after over a year of inactivity.
At the start of April it was reported that he had been at WWE Headquarters signing a deal to return to WWE and was working on plans for his comeback.
Big E has now stated that Rusev himself has confirmed the news to him.
During a WWE/Fanatics livestream today, Big E and Tyler Breeze were opening WWE trading cards when they opened a pack that contained a Rusev 2017 card.
Upon seeing the card, Big E said:
“I reached out to him and he confirmed that the news is indeed true. I don’t know when he’ll be back. A blast from the past and actually it’s very topical because he has just announced that he is returning to the squared circle here in World Wrestling Entertainment.”
No exact details have emerged on how or when Rusev will return to WWE TV – we’ll keep you posted with any further updates.
